While Yorkshire Terriers might be small, their care requirements can be substantial. Owners must be gotten ready for grooming, workout, and health care. Here's a breakdown of what it requires to take care of a Yorkie Welpen puppy:
1. Grooming Needs
Yorkshire Terriers have a gorgeous coat that requires routine maintenance. Here's an easy grooming schedule:
Grooming TaskFrequencyBrushingDaily (to prevent tangles and matting)BathingEvery 2 to 4 weeks (or as needed)Nail TrimmingEvery 3 to 4 weeks (to avoid overgrowth and pain)Ear CleaningWeekly (to avoid infections and wax accumulation)Teeth Brushing2 to 3 times each week (to prevent oral concerns)2. Dietary Requirements
A correct diet is important for the health and well-being of a Yorkshire Terrier puppy. Here's a fast overview of their dietary requirements:
Diet ComponentDescriptionPuppy Formulated FoodPremium industrial puppy food that meets AAFCO standards ought to be the structure.ProteinA minimum of 22% protein material in their food for optimal development and development.FatApproximately 8% fat for energy and healthy skin/coat.Fresh WaterConstantly ensure they have access to fresh and clean water.3. Exercise Requirements
In spite of their small size, Yorkshire Terriers are active little dogs. They need day-to-day exercise to maintain their health and happiness. Here's what's advised:
Exercise TypePeriodPlaytime30 to 60 minutes of interactive play dailyLeash Walks20 to 30 minutes on a leash to check out the outdoorsMental StimulationPuzzle toys and training exercises to keep their minds engagedHealth Considerations
Yorkshire Terriers, like any breed, can be prone to certain health issues. Here are some common conditions to be familiar with:
Health IssueDescriptionPatellar LuxationDislocation of the kneecap; may require surgical intervention.Hip DysplasiaA genetic condition that can cause discomfort and movement issues.Oral ProblemsDue to their small mouths, Yorkies are at risk for dental problems; routine oral care is essential.Routine Veterinary Care
Routine check-ups with a vet are important for monitoring your puppy's health. Vaccinations, parasite avoidance, and oral care ought to all be part of their ongoing health regimen.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Are Yorkshire Terrier puppies great for families?
Yes, Yorkshire Terriers can make excellent household pets, however they may not appropriate for families with very kids due to their small size and fragility.
2. How do you train a Yorkshire Terrier Adoptieren Terrier puppy?
Favorable support approaches, like treats and praise, work best as Yorkies can be persistent. Consistency and perseverance are crucial.
3. Do Yorkshire Terrier puppies shed?
Yorkshire Terriers are thought about hypoallergenic as they shed very little hair, making them ideal for allergic reaction victims.
4. How often should I take my Yorkie on strolls?
Daily leash walks of 20 to 30 minutes, in addition to playtime, will help fulfill their workout needs.
5. What should I feed my Yorkshire Terrier puppy?
Select a premium puppy food with substantial protein content, and constantly ensure fresh water is offered.
